Fig. 1.6 The Earth’s radiation balance Solar radiation (yellow) warms the Earth’s atmosphere and the Earth’s surface, and is released as heat radiation (red). Part of the heat radiation is transmitted back to Earth by gases in the atmosphere, turning the atmosphere into a sort of natural greenhouse (according to NASA).
